The Sacred Balance of Power and Grace
The image of Goddess Durga riding her lion is more than a mythological symbol—it’s a profound reminder of balance. The lion represents power, instinct, and raw energy, while Durga embodies calmness, wisdom, and grace. Together, they represent the union of strength and serenity, of courage and compassion.
In our own lives, this balance is essential. To live with purpose, we must learn when to roar and when to be still, when to act with determination and when to surrender to patience. Power without grace becomes aggression, while grace without courage becomes passivity. True Shakti lies in harmonizing both.
The Weight of Unexpressed Emotions
Many people silently carry emotional burdens—grief, guilt, shame, or fear—that have never been given space to heal. We are taught to appear fine, to smile through the pain, and to keep moving forward. But the body and mind remember what we try to forget. Unprocessed emotions can manifest as anxiety, burnout, or a constant feeling of emptiness.
Therapy, reflection, and compassionate conversation offer ways to gently unpack that emotional weight. Seeking help is not a sign of weakness; it is an act of self-respect. Just as we care for our physical health, our emotional well-being too deserves attention, care, and understanding. Everyone deserves the chance to feel lighter, to heal, and to rediscover peace.
